Environment Parameter Gradient Theorem for Policy-Environment Co-Design in Reinforcement Learning
Reinforcement learning (RL) is traditionally concerned with learning a control policy for a fixed environment. In many engineering systems, however, the environment itself is alterable: physical or operational parameters can be tuned to shape the transition dynamics and costs experienced by the agent. This motivates jointly optimizing both the policy and the environment design parameters. To this end, we establish an Environment Parameter Gradient Theorem -- a formal expression for the gradient…
